Sometimes, athlete’s foot can drive you crazy. Itchy feet can be very irritating. It can get to the point where it becomes painful and starts burning. Sometimes you think you have it under control, but it returns with a vengeance. Here are some home remedies for athletes foot to end this annoying problem.
Take note
- You should always keep your feet covered, no matter where you are in public. Athletes’ foot loves gyms, swimming pools and locker rooms. These areas can be a breeding ground for the fungus that causes athletes foot. It is possible to prevent this disease from spreading.
- Soak your feet in warm water – This treatment is great for athletes’ feet. Combine 4-5 tablespoons salt and a gallon warm water. Allow the solution to sit for 15 minutes on your feet. If you wish, you can apply an antifungal lotion to your feet.
- Bake soda is another home remedy for athletes’ foot. Mix a tablespoon of baking powder with some water. Make it into a paste-like substance. Apply this to the affected area of your feet. Rinse it off and allow your feet to dry.
- Take care of your feet – Shoes are an important part of any athlete’s foot prevention. This is easy to fix. Apply a medicated powder to the inside of your shoes once every two days. To combat the fungus in shoes, you can also use a medicated spray.
- Change your socks – Do your feet sweat all the time or do they tend to get dry easily? You should change your socks at least twice a day. You can bring an extra pair of socks to work, and change them during lunch breaks.
- Remove the old, dead skin. This is an important part in athletes foot treatment. Dead skin protects the living fungi. Use a small brush or a toothbrush to scrub your feet. Also, spend some time between your toes.
